PoE 2 0.5 CoC Gemling Build: Budget Frost Wall Setup Destroys 200% Delirium
Summary
Gemling Legionnaire is arguably the best ascendancy in Path of Exile 2, and this build demonstrates exactly why. With minimal investment-under 10 divines for most pieces-this Cast on Crit Spark build can easily clear 200% delirious Tier 15 maps. The core mechanic revolves around Frost Wall's ice crystal life being converted into massive cold damage through the Virglas support gem.
The build is simple to set up, requires no expensive mana stacking, and generates infinite damage through a self-sustaining loop of critical strikes, freezes, and comets.
Part 1: Why Gemling Legionnaire
Gemling Legionnaire excels for this build due to several key nodes. Advanced Thaumaturgy grants extra effects based on gem quality, with Spark gaining eight additional projectiles at high quality. Virtuous Barrier provides Mind over Matter, offering strong mana regen. Neurological Implants give plus two levels to all skills. Gem Studded provides 40% less movement speed penalty while casting, 30% less mana cost, and critical immunity-all of which are powerful for any Spark-based build.
The ascendancy also provides 12% quality to all gems, which is crucial for scaling Frost Wall's ice crystal life and Spark's projectile count.
Part 2: The Core Damage Mechanic - Virglas
Virglas is the support gem that makes this build function. The gem grants 1% of damage gained as extra cold per 2,000 maximum life of destroyed ice crystals. With Frost Wall scaling to over 460,000 ice crystal life, this translates to roughly 230% of damage gained as extra cold-far exceeding what Archmage can provide without extreme mana investment.
Frost Wall's base life scales with gem level. At level 31, the skill has roughly 21,000 base life, multiplied by 960% increased crystal life from quality and passive nodes, then doubled via Glacier support. This results in the 460,000 total lives that drive the damage conversion.
The key interaction is that destroying an ice crystal grants the buff permanently as long as Frost Walls continue to be destroyed. Since the build automatically spawns Frost Walls through Cast on Crit and Cast on Elemental Ailment, this buff has 100% uptime.
Part 3: The Infinite Loop
The build operates on a self-sustaining loop. Spark fires rapidly, dealing cold damage through Virglas's extra cold conversion. This quickly freezes enemies, generating massive energy for Cast on Elemental Ailment. CoEA triggers Comet repeatedly, which crits and spawns Frost Walls via Cast on Crit. The comets destroy the Frost Walls, proccing Virglas again and generating more cold damage. The Frost Walls themselves deal additional damage and contribute to the loop.
The loop is further enhanced by Adorned's Ego. This unique buff consumes power charges to grant 15% more damage per charge consumed. With eight power charges, this provides a 110% multiplicative damage increase. It also causes all elemental damage to contribute to chill, freeze, and ignite, which is essential for maintaining the Cast on Elemental Ailment loop.
Power charges are easily generated by using Frost Bomb on weapon set two to create elemental infusions, then consuming them with Firestorm.
Part 4: Gem Setup
Spark
Gem quality provides increased projectiles and projectile speed. Supports include:
Virglas: Core damage conversion
Pinpoint Critical: Increased critical strike chance
Zenith: Mana cost reduction (replace with Pierce for mapping)
Mobility: Reduced movement speed penalty
Cast on Elemental Ailment
Comet: Primary damage skill; quality provides 80% increased damage against frozen enemies
Spell Cascade: Increases area coverage
Living Bomb: Provides fire infusions for the comet
Arbiter's Ignition: Grants Archon, providing more elemental damage and 100% more freeze buildup
Boundless Energy: Damage multiplier
Cast on Crit
Frost Wall: Spawns ice crystals
Glacier: Doubles ice crystal life
Cold Mastery: Increases ice crystal life
Pinpoint Critical: Improved crit chance
Auras and Buffs
Mana Remnants: Mana sustain
Siphon Elements: Elemental infusions
Clarity: Mana regeneration
Part 5: Gear Overview
Core Items
Adorned's Ego: Required unique wand. Consumes power and charges for a massive damage boost. Cost is negligible.
Scepter with Spirit: Provides enough spirit for all auras and trigger gems. Cost under 1 divine.
Dialla's Desire: Optional but recommended. Provides extra quality and gem levels for Frost Wall. Expensive but not required for the budget version.
Sacred Flame Shield: Provides spirit for auras. Cost under 1 divine for a basic version.
Maligaro's Cruelty: Gloves that fix critical damage at 250%, allowing pure crit chance scaling. Very cheap.
Jewelry
Rings with cast speed and mana cost efficiency
Ingenuity Belt (optional) to boost ring effectiveness
Darkness Enthroned (alternative) to buff Fox's Idol for additional quality
Fox's Idol Jewel
Provides 5% quality to all gems. Socket in the belt for additional scaling.
Budget Considerations
The full build, excluding the helmet, can be assembled for under 10 divines. Resistances can be solved through simple ring and gear choices rather than expensive mageblood setups.
Part 6: Passive Tree and Power Charge Generation
The passive tree prioritizes critical strike chance, cast speed, and ice crystal life. Key nodes include:
Thin Ice: Freeze buildup
Heavy Frost: Ignore elemental resistance on enemies with freeze buildup
Power Charge nodes: Extra maximum charges
Arcane Surge nodes: Cast speed and mana regen
Power charge generation uses weapon set two. Equip Frost Bomb and Firestorm on this set. Place Frost Bomb, consume the infusion with Firestorm, and repeat to gain eight power charges. Swap to weapon set one, press Pinnacle Power, and receive the buff for one minute.
This process takes seconds and only needs to be performed at the start of a map or when the buff wears off.
Part 7: Mapping Strategy
Starting the Map
At the map entrance, use Frost Bomb twice and Firestorm twice to generate eight power charges. Swap to weapon set one and press Pinnacle Power. Place a manual Frost Wall and destroy it to proc Virglas. Now fully buffed, Spark will freeze everything instantly, triggering the infinite comet loop.
Clear Speed
Once the loop begins, the build clears maps at high speed. Cast on Elemental Ailment generates comets rapidly, and the comets crit to spawn Frost Walls, which are instantly destroyed by Spark. This creates a cascade of damage that overwhelms everything on screen. 200% delirious maps with 80% monster effectiveness are easily cleared.
Defensive Considerations
The build is naturally defensive due to freezing enemies, eliminating their ability to attack. Gem Studded provides critical immunity, and the high freeze buildup renders most threats harmless. Mind over Matter provides additional EHP, but resistances must still be capped.
Part 8: Upgrading from Budget to Endgame
Immediate Upgrades
Level 21 Comet and Spark gems
Additional spell levels on gear
Better movement speed boots
More cast speed on rings
Mid-Term Upgrades
Dialla's Desire for Frost Wall scaling
Better jewels with crit chance, cast speed, and spell damage
From Nothing jewel to allocate powerful notables
Endgame Options
Temporalis for increased blink range and cooldown recovery
Mageblood for permanent flask effects
Alpha's Howl helmet for additional quality and defenses
Runic Fork for extra spell levels
